Stock Photo - PRODUCTION - 21 August 2023, Saxony, Leipzig: In the depot of the university's art collection, art historian Simone Tübbecke compares the original fragments of the Fürstenhaus oriel from the 16th century, which were restored in recent years by the Berlin stone conservator Thomas Schubert and are now in storage, with an old photograph. After extensive restoration, fragments of the Fürstenhaus oriel have now returned to Leipzig. They belong to one of the most magnificent Renaissance buildings in the fair city, which was destroyed in a bombing raid during World War II. The fragments are to return to the former site of the Fürstenhaus after some 80 years. Photo: Waltraud Grubitzsch/dpa/ZB. - Leipzig/Saxony/Germany
